Default AMD, Intel throw dust cloud in buyers' faces

IF YOU'RE IN the market for a new PC, you will find that despite the best efforts of Intel and AMD to obfuscate the matter with weird numbers, plus signs and letters of the alphabet, retailers and dealers still understand what you want to buy.

That would be why whether you want to buy a notebook, a desktop PC or a server, the shops and the resellers will still helpfully provide you with a megahertz number, thank the lord. They realise that the "end user" - that's you and me folk - need some kind of benchmark to rely on. Bangs for Bucks (TM) would be great, but if you think the CPU vendors are going to give you that, well dream on.
